Originally Posted by Braaapjeep
From their tech directly, any rubicon locker will fit, that's why they say ox, ARB 35 spline, and factory, regular 44 has different bearings but if it will fit in a rubicon 44 front, it should fit in this one
Eaton does not make a locker that will fit into a Rubicon housing. If the DV8 housing only accepts a factory type locker (Rubicon, ARB, or OX) - these are the same options for a stock housing.
